| +String MediaRecorder::canRecordMimeType(const String& mimeType) |
| +{ |
| + RawPtr<WebMediaRecorderHandler> handler = Platform::current()->createMediaRecorderHandler(); |
| + if (!handler) |
| + return ""; |
| + |
| + // MediaRecorder canRecordMimeType() MUST return 'probably' "if the UA is |
| + // confident that mimeType represents a type that it can record" [1], but a |
| + // number of reasons could prevent the recording from happening as expected, |
| + // so 'maybe' is a better option: "Implementors are encouraged to return |
| + // "maybe" unless the type can be confidently established as being supported |
| + // or not.". Hence this method returns '' or 'maybe', never 'probably'. |
| + // [1] http://w3c.github.io/mediacapture-record/MediaRecorder.html#methods |
